Quick Beef and Broccoli Stir Fry in 30 Minutes

Ingredients You’ll Need

To make this Easy Homemade Beef and Broccoli Stir Fry, gather the following ingredients:

  • 1 pound of beef (flank steak or sirloin), thinly sliced against the grain
  • 4 cups of fresh broccoli florets
  • 2 tablespoons of vegetable oil (or any high-heat oil of your choice)
  • 3 cloves of garlic, minced
  • 1 tablespoon of ginger, minced
  • 1/4 cup of soy sauce
  • 2 tablespoons of oyster sauce (optional for extra flavor)
  • 1 tablespoon of cornstarch
  • 1/2 cup of beef broth or water
  • 1 teaspoon of sesame oil
  • Cooked rice or noodles, for serving
  • Sesame seeds and chopped green onions for garnish (optional)

Preparation Steps

Now that you have your ingredients ready, follow these simple steps to prepare your stir fry:

1. Marinate the Beef

Start by marinating the sliced beef to enhance its flavor and tenderness. In a bowl, combine the soy sauce, oyster sauce, cornstarch, and a splash of sesame oil. Add the beef slices and mix well, ensuring each piece is coated. Let it marinate for about 10-15 minutes while you prepare the other ingredients.

2. Prepare the Broccoli

While the beef is marinating, wash and cut the broccoli into bite-sized florets. If you prefer a bit more texture, you can blanch the broccoli in boiling water for 2-3 minutes, then transfer it to ice water to stop the cooking process. This step helps the broccoli retain its vibrant green color and crunch.

3. Heat the Oil

In a large skillet or wok, heat the vegetable oil over medium-high heat. Ensure the oil is hot before adding the beef to achieve a nice sear.

4. Cook the Beef

Add the marinated beef to the skillet in a single layer. Let it cook without stirring for about 2 minutes, allowing it to sear. After that, stir-fry the beef for another 2-3 minutes until it’s browned and just cooked through. Remove the beef from the skillet and set it aside on a plate.

5. Stir-fry the Broccoli

In the same skillet, add a bit more oil if necessary. Toss in the minced garlic and ginger, stirring for about 30 seconds until fragrant. Then, add the broccoli florets and stir-fry for about 3-4 minutes. You want them to be bright green and tender-crisp.

6. Combine Everything

Return the cooked beef to the skillet with the broccoli. Pour in the beef broth (or water) and stir everything together. Let it cook for an additional 2-3 minutes to allow the flavors to meld and the sauce to thicken slightly. If you find the sauce too thick, add a splash more broth or water.

7. Serve and Garnish

Once everything is well combined and heated through, remove the skillet from the heat. Serve the beef and broccoli stir fry over cooked rice or noodles. For a finishing touch, sprinkle with sesame seeds and chopped green onions, if desired.

Tips for the Perfect Stir Fry

To ensure your Easy Homemade Beef and Broccoli Stir Fry comes out perfectly every time, keep these tips in mind:

  • Slice the Beef Thinly: Cutting the beef against the grain helps to tenderize the meat. Thin slices will cook quickly and remain juicy.
  • Prep Before Cooking: Stir frying is a quick process, so have all your ingredients prepped and ready to go before you start cooking.
  • High Heat is Key: Cooking on high heat allows you to achieve that characteristic stir-fried flavor and texture. Don’t overcrowd the pan; cook in batches if necessary.
  • Use Fresh Ingredients: Fresh broccoli and aromatics will enhance the flavor of your dish significantly. Whenever possible, avoid frozen vegetables for stir fries.
  • Customize Your Veggies: Feel free to add other vegetables, such as bell peppers, snap peas, or carrots, for added color and nutrition.

Storing Leftovers

If you happen to have any leftovers, you can easily store them for later. Here’s how:

  • Cool Down: Allow the stir fry to cool to room temperature before storing.
  • Use Airtight Containers: Transfer the leftovers into airtight containers to maintain freshness.
  • Refrigerate: Store in the refrigerator for up to 3 days. Reheat in the microwave or on the stovetop.
  • Freezing: For longer storage, you can freeze the stir fry for up to 2 months. Just make sure to use freezer-safe containers.
